Russian President Vladimir Putin and Chinese President Xi Jinping held a call to affirm their countries' strong relationship, emphasizing shared interests and mutual benefits. This conversation comes right after Donald Trump's inauguration as the 47th U.S. president. With China being a significant buyer of Russian oil and gas amid Western sanctions, both leaders highlighted their collaboration for a multipolar global order and stability in Eurasia. The timing suggests a coordinated approach in dealing with the new U.S. administration under Trump, who has expressed both confrontational and cooperative stances towards China, and a willingness to engage with Russia on global issues.

The dialogue between Putin and Xi underscores the strategic partnership between Moscow and Beijing, particularly in the context of escalating geopolitical tensions and economic sanctions against Russia. Putin's openness to engaging with Trump indicates a potential shift in U.S.-Russia relations, especially concerning the Ukraine conflict. Both countries appear to be setting the stage for diplomatic interactions with the U.S., potentially reshaping the global power dynamics. The emphasis on a stable and just international order reflects their joint ambition to counterbalance Western influence, particularly in light of Trump's previous rhetoric on trade and security issues.
